Output 20513cb7597fe55c57b66d59928e09c06feb651ca68b1200c3d396366ce07f17:0

value
4951973
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c5e3d39bd663f248a0e81b1d1e01ddae415426e OP_EQUALVERIFY OP_CHECKSIG
address
13azpDwJdPySBnF81VUFLhiWLCFjNC9d96
transaction
20513cb7597fe55c57b66d59928e09c06feb651ca68b1200c3d396366ce07f17
confirmations
692332
spent
true